  • Patent number: 10400114
    Abstract: A composition comprising an ethylene (meth)acrylic acid copolymer and an anti-fouling agent is provided. The composition selectively disintegrates in media of different ionic strengths. Also provided is a method of preventing fouling using the composition.
    Type: Grant
    Filed: September 25, 2014
    Date of Patent: September 3, 2019
    Assignee: Rohm and Haas Company
    Inventors: Scott Backer, Afia S. Karikari, Paul Mercando

  • Publication number: 20120041166
    Abstract: A method for preparing a polymer containing zinc ion, calcium ion or magnesium ion; polymerized residues of 0.5 to 7 wt % itaconic acid and 4 to 15 wt % (meth)acrylic acid. The polymer has a Tg from 50 to 110° C. The method includes forming a polymerization mixture having from 0.5 to 8 wt % of a di-(meth)acrylate salt of zinc, calcium or magnesium ion.
    Type: Application
    Filed: August 5, 2011
    Publication date: February 16, 2012
    Inventors: Afia S. Karikari, Theodore Tysak
